package org.cip4.jdflib.auto;
import java.util.Collection;
import java.util.Iterator;
import java.util.List;
import java.util.Map;
import org.apache.commons.lang.enums.ValuedEnum;
import org.apache.xerces.dom.CoreDocumentImpl;
import org.cip4.jdflib.core.AtrInfoTable;
import org.cip4.jdflib.core.AttributeInfo;
import org.cip4.jdflib.core.AttributeName;
import org.cip4.jdflib.core.ElemInfoTable;
import org.cip4.jdflib.core.ElementInfo;
import org.cip4.jdflib.core.ElementName;
import org.cip4.jdflib.core.JDFCoreConstants;
import org.cip4.jdflib.core.JDFElement;
import org.cip4.jdflib.jmf.JDFQueueEntry;
import org.cip4.jdflib.resource.JDFDevice;
/**
*****************************************************************************
* class JDFAutoQueue : public JDFElement
*****************************************************************************
*
*/
public abstract class JDFAutoQueue extends JDFElement
{
private static final long serialVersionUID = 1L;
private static AtrInfoTable[] atrInfoTable = new AtrInfoTable[4];
static
{
atrInfoTable[0] = new AtrInfoTable(AttributeName.STATUS, 0x2222222222l, AttributeInfo.EnumAttributeType.enumeration, EnumQueueStatus.getEnum(0), null);
atrInfoTable[1] = new AtrInfoTable(AttributeName.DEVICEID, 0x2222222222l, AttributeInfo.EnumAttributeType.shortString, null, null);
atrInfoTable[2] = new AtrInfoTable(AttributeName.MAXQUEUESIZE, 0x3333111111l, AttributeInfo.EnumAttributeType.integer, null, null);
atrInfoTable[3] = new AtrInfoTable(AttributeName.QUEUESIZE, 0x3333333311l, AttributeInfo.EnumAttributeType.integer, null, null);
}
@Override
protected AttributeInfo getTheAttributeInfo()
{
return super.getTheAttributeInfo().updateReplace(atrInfoTable);
}
private static ElemInfoTable[] elemInfoTable = new ElemInfoTable[2];
static
{
elemInfoTable[0] = new ElemInfoTable(ElementName.DEVICE, 0x3333333333l);
elemInfoTable[1] = new ElemInfoTable(ElementName.QUEUEENTRY, 0x3333333333l);
}
@Override
protected ElementInfo getTheElementInfo()
{
return super.getTheElementInfo().updateReplace(elemInfoTable);
}
/**
* Constructor for JDFAutoQueue
*
* @param myOwnerDocument
* @param qualifiedName
*/
protected JDFAutoQueue(CoreDocumentImpl myOwnerDocument, String qualifiedName)
{
super(myOwnerDocument, qualifiedName);
}
/**
* Constructor for JDFAutoQueue
*
* @param myOwnerDocument
* @param myNamespaceURI
* @param qualifiedName
*/
protected JDFAutoQueue(CoreDocumentImpl myOwnerDocument, String myNamespaceURI, String qualifiedName)
{
super(myOwnerDocument, myNamespaceURI, qualifiedName);
}
/**
* Constructor for JDFAutoQueue
*
* @param myOwnerDocument
* @param myNamespaceURI
* @param qualifiedName
* @param myLocalName
*/
protected JDFAutoQueue(CoreDocumentImpl myOwnerDocument, String myNamespaceURI, String qualifiedName, String myLocalName)
{
super(myOwnerDocument, myNamespaceURI, qualifiedName, myLocalName);
}
/**
* Enumeration strings for QueueStatus
*/
@SuppressWarnings("rawtypes")
public static class EnumQueueStatus extends ValuedEnum
{
private static final long serialVersionUID = 1L;
private static int m_startValue = 0;
protected EnumQueueStatus(String name)
{
super(name, m_startValue++);
}
/**
* @param enumName the string to convert
* @return the enum
*/
public static EnumQueueStatus getEnum(String enumName)
{
return (EnumQueueStatus) getEnum(EnumQueueStatus.class, enumName);
}
/**
* @param enumValue the integer to convert
* @return the enum
*/
public static EnumQueueStatus getEnum(int enumValue)
{
return (EnumQueueStatus) getEnum(EnumQueueStatus.class, enumValue);
}
/**
* @return the map of enums
*/
public static Map getEnumMap()
{
return getEnumMap(EnumQueueStatus.class);
}
/**
* @return the list of enums
*/
public static List getEnumList()
{
return getEnumList(EnumQueueStatus.class);
}
/**
* @return the iterator
*/
public static Iterator iterator()
{
return iterator(EnumQueueStatus.class);
}
/** */
public static final EnumQueueStatus Blocked = new EnumQueueStatus("Blocked");
/** */
public static final EnumQueueStatus Closed = new EnumQueueStatus("Closed");
/** */
public static final EnumQueueStatus Full = new EnumQueueStatus("Full");
/** */
public static final EnumQueueStatus Running = new EnumQueueStatus("Running");
/** */
public static final EnumQueueStatus Waiting = new EnumQueueStatus("Waiting");
/** */
public static final EnumQueueStatus Held = new EnumQueueStatus("Held");
}
/*
* ************************************************************************ Attribute getter / setter ************************************************************************
*/
/*
* --------------------------------------------------------------------- Methods for Attribute Status ---------------------------------------------------------------------
*/
/**
* (5) set attribute Status
*
* @param enumVar the enumVar to set the attribute to
*/
public void setQueueStatus(EnumQueueStatus enumVar)
{
setAttribute(AttributeName.STATUS, enumVar == null ? null : enumVar.getName(), null);
}
/**
* (9) get attribute Status
*
* @return the value of the attribute
*/
public EnumQueueStatus getQueueStatus()
{
return EnumQueueStatus.getEnum(getAttribute(AttributeName.STATUS, null, null));
}
/*
* --------------------------------------------------------------------- Methods for Attribute DeviceID ---------------------------------------------------------------------
*/
/**
* (36) set attribute DeviceID
*
* @param value the value to set the attribute to
*/
public void setDeviceID(String value)
{
setAttribute(AttributeName.DEVICEID, value, null);
}
/**
* (23) get String attribute DeviceID
*
* @return the value of the attribute
*/
public String getDeviceID()
{
return getAttribute(AttributeName.DEVICEID, null, JDFCoreConstants.EMPTYSTRING);
}
/*
* --------------------------------------------------------------------- Methods for Attribute MaxQueueSize
* ---------------------------------------------------------------------
*/
/**
* (36) set attribute MaxQueueSize
*
* @param value the value to set the attribute to
*/
public void setMaxQueueSize(int value)
{
setAttribute(AttributeName.MAXQUEUESIZE, value, null);
}
/**
* (15) get int attribute MaxQueueSize
*
* @return int the value of the attribute
*/
public int getMaxQueueSize()
{
return getIntAttribute(AttributeName.MAXQUEUESIZE, null, 0);
}
/*
* --------------------------------------------------------------------- Methods for Attribute QueueSize ---------------------------------------------------------------------
*/
/**
* (36) set attribute QueueSize
*
* @param value the value to set the attribute to
*/
public void setQueueSize(int value)
{
setAttribute(AttributeName.QUEUESIZE, value, null);
}
/**
* (15) get int attribute QueueSize
*
* @return int the value of the attribute
*/
public int getQueueSize()
{
return getIntAttribute(AttributeName.QUEUESIZE, null, 0);
}
/*
* *********************************************************************** Element getter / setter ***********************************************************************
*/
/**
* (24) const get element Device
*
* @return JDFDevice the element
*/
public JDFDevice getDevice()
{
return (JDFDevice) getElement(ElementName.DEVICE, null, 0);
}
/**
* (25) getCreateDevice
*
* @return JDFDevice the element
*/
public JDFDevice getCreateDevice()
{
return (JDFDevice) getCreateElement_JDFElement(ElementName.DEVICE, null, 0);
}
/**
* (26) getCreateDevice
*
* @param iSkip number of elements to skip
* @return JDFDevice the element
*/
public JDFDevice getCreateDevice(int iSkip)
{
return (JDFDevice) getCreateElement_JDFElement(ElementName.DEVICE, null, iSkip);
}
/**
* (27) const get element Device
*
* @param iSkip number of elements to skip
* @return JDFDevice the element default is getDevice(0)
*/
public JDFDevice getDevice(int iSkip)
{
return (JDFDevice) getElement(ElementName.DEVICE, null, iSkip);
}
/**
* Get all Device from the current element
*
* @return Collection, null if none are available
*/
public Collection getAllDevice()
{
return getChildArrayByClass(JDFDevice.class, false, 0);
}
/**
* (30) append element Device
*
* @return JDFDevice the element
*/
public JDFDevice appendDevice()
{
return (JDFDevice) appendElement(ElementName.DEVICE, null);
}
/**
* (24) const get element QueueEntry
*
* @return JDFQueueEntry the element
*/
public JDFQueueEntry getQueueEntry()
{
return (JDFQueueEntry) getElement(ElementName.QUEUEENTRY, null, 0);
}
/**
* (25) getCreateQueueEntry
*
* @return JDFQueueEntry the element
*/
public JDFQueueEntry getCreateQueueEntry()
{
return (JDFQueueEntry) getCreateElement_JDFElement(ElementName.QUEUEENTRY, null, 0);
}
/**
* (26) getCreateQueueEntry
*
* @param iSkip number of elements to skip
* @return JDFQueueEntry the element
*/
public JDFQueueEntry getCreateQueueEntry(int iSkip)
{
return (JDFQueueEntry) getCreateElement_JDFElement(ElementName.QUEUEENTRY, null, iSkip);
}
/**
* (27) const get element QueueEntry
*
* @param iSkip number of elements to skip
* @return JDFQueueEntry the element default is getQueueEntry(0)
*/
public JDFQueueEntry getQueueEntry(int iSkip)
{
return (JDFQueueEntry) getElement(ElementName.QUEUEENTRY, null, iSkip);
}
/**
* Get all QueueEntry from the current element
*
* @return Collection, null if none are available
*/
public Collection getAllQueueEntry()
{
return getChildArrayByClass(JDFQueueEntry.class, false, 0);
}
/**
* (30) append element QueueEntry
*
* @return JDFQueueEntry the element
*/
public JDFQueueEntry appendQueueEntry()
{
return (JDFQueueEntry) appendElement(ElementName.QUEUEENTRY, null);
}
}
